😐A single person spends $2,626 per month in Paris vs $1,799 in Divonne les Bains,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$4,013 per month in Paris vs $2,788 in Divonne les Bains,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$5,400 per month in Paris vs $3,777 in Divonne les Bains, rent included.
😐Paris costs about 46% more than Divonne les Bains, driven mainly by Getting Around.
📊Both Paris and Divonne les Bains sit above the global median – Paris by 96%, Divonne les Bains by 34%.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$1,664 in Paris versus $783 in Divonne les Bains.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 90% higher in Paris,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$73 in Paris versus $59 in Divonne les Bains.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$413 vs $368 – making Divonne les Bains the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
